A heavily traveled local route has been named part of one of America's best road trips. Route 9 is more than 300 miles long and goes from the Canadian border all the way to Delaware. The 57 mile stretch through the lower New York and the Hudson Valley has been named by MSN as one of the best in the country.

The Hudson Valley is in good company as the Florida Keys, Maui and the Pacific Coast Highway in California are all in the running. Another local road, the Merritt Parkway in Connecticut was mentioned as well.

Many of us think of route 9 as a commercial hub, that's not the case for much of the route. There are many sections with river views, historic mansions and even farmer's markets. Through New Jersey it runs parallel to the Garden State Parkway while in New York it runs parallel to the New York State Thruway.
